本文共计857字,预计需要花费 2分钟才能阅读完成。
DAO安全漏洞防范的重要性
随着去中心化自治组织(DAO)的快速发展,其安全问题日益凸显。DAO作为区块链技术的创新应用,通过智能合约实现组织治理和资金管理,但其开放性也带来诸多安全风险。2022年发生的多起DAO黑客攻击事件,造成数亿美元损失,凸显了安全防范的紧迫性。
常见DAO安全漏洞类型
- 智能合约漏洞:重入攻击、整数溢出等编程缺陷
- 治理机制缺陷:投票权集中、提案执行漏洞
- 前端攻击:钓鱼网站、恶意JavaScript注入
- 私钥管理不当:多签设置不合理、密钥存储不安全
- 预言机操纵:数据源被控制导致错误决策
DAO安全最佳实践
建立完善的DAO安全体系需要从技术和管理两个层面着手:
技术防护措施
- 采用形式化验证工具检查智能合约
- 实施多签钱包和交易延迟机制
- 集成安全监控和异常报警系统
- 定期进行第三方安全审计
- 使用去中心化存储保护关键数据
治理安全优化
- 设计合理的投票权重分配机制
- 设置关键决策的法定人数要求
- 实施提案冷却期和紧急制动机制
- 建立分阶段资金释放制度
- 培养社区成员的安全意识
DAO安全审计流程
专业的DAO安全审计应包含以下步骤:
- 需求分析与威胁建模
- 智能合约静态分析
- 动态测试和模糊测试
- 经济模型压力测试
- 治理机制模拟攻击
- 审计报告和修复验证
DAO安全事件应急响应
当安全事件发生时,DAO应具备快速响应能力:
- 立即暂停可疑交易和合约功能
- 启动紧急治理投票流程
- 追踪资金流向并与交易所合作冻结
- 透明公开事件进展和应对措施
- 事后进行全面复盘和系统升级
未来DAO安全发展趋势
随着技术进步,DAO安全将呈现以下趋势:
- AI驱动的智能合约漏洞检测
- 零知识证明在治理中的应用
- 去中心化安全服务网络
- 跨链安全标准的建立
- DAO安全保险产品的普及
DAO的安全建设是一个持续的过程,需要开发者、治理参与者和安全专家的共同努力。只有建立完善的安全体系,DAO才能真正实现其去中心化自治的愿景。
正文完